Indonesia, as the largest economy in Southeast Asia and a critical maritime crossroads, presents a unique set of challenges and opportunities for manufacturers and factory owners. With over 17,000 islands, the logistics network is inherently complex, relying heavily on inter-island shipping, congested ports like Tanjung Priok (Jakarta) and Tanjung Perak (Surabaya), and a rapidly developing but still maturing road infrastructure.
The "Making Indonesia 4.0" initiative has propelled sectors like automotive, electronics, textiles, and chemicals into the global spotlight. However, this industrial boom comes with increased exposure to logistics risks. From the volcanic activity of the "Ring of Fire" to maritime piracy in the Malacca Strait and the seasonal challenges of the monsoon, freight insurance is not just an option—it is a strategic necessity for Indonesian manufacturers.

Managing high-value electronics shipments from Batam to global markets requires specialized "All-Risk" insurance coverage to protect against transshipment risks in Singapore.
For factories in Bandung and Semarang, we provide insurance that covers inland transit risks, protecting against road accidents and theft during the journey to the port.
Heavy machinery for the nickel mining industry in Sulawesi requires project cargo insurance with specific clauses for loading and unloading in remote locations.
